**Q: Is sorting stable in the Lanternquill report builder?**

Yes. When you sort by a column, rows that compare equal keep their previous relative order. This means you can build multi-level sorts by applying them in reverse priority: sort by the tiebreaker first, then by the primary column. Contractors sometimes assume the engine re-shuffles ties; it does not, and regression tests in the Veldmark suite enforce this. If you need to unlock the legacy sort-config vault, use the recovery passphrase below.

unlock words, kagef-taduf: fenir-quenix-norwyn-sorvan-gormir-gorir-fraok

## Step 4: Point your plugin at the new partner SFTP drop

As of the Quartzline 3.2 rollout, Fernwick Logistics no longer accepts uploads to the legacy drop path. Plugin authors must update their transfer hooks to target the new partner endpoint and verify host-key pinning before enabling automatic retries. Failure to do so will silently queue files in the dead-letter folder, which is purged nightly. Once your hook compiles against the v3 SDK, apply the connection settings below exactly as shown.

config for kagup-hahig:
druwyn:
  pin: 2801
  metrics_host: metrics.druwyn.zemvarlabs.internal
  tenant: sorius
  seal: seal_798a43d7

## Key Ceremony Checklist — Item 7: Pinpoint Autocomplete Widget

Before rotating the signing keys for the Pinpoint address-autocomplete widget, confirm the suggestion cache is drained and the fallback typeahead is serving traffic. Don't skip the smoke test on the staging form — it's bitten us twice. Once both witnesses have signed off, unlock the ceremony kit using the recovery passphrase printed below.

strongbox words: norwyn-wenael-aldvan-aldiel-wendor-holael

// Max tiles held in the Glazecache hot layer.
// Support folks: if customers report stale or missing map tiles,
// this is the first knob to check. Raising it past 50k tends to
// blow the memory budget on the small render nodes, so don't.
// Changes here must go through a full render-farm redeploy.
// When opening a ticket about this constant, quote the build token below.

pipeline stamp: htk31_f769b577b3028a4e9958e5bb8d1259a